有机肥替代化肥对稻谷产量及氮素吸收利用的影响  被引量:2

Effects of Different Organic-Inorganic Fertilizer Combinations on Yield and Nitrogen Uptake and Utilization of Rice

摘  要:为了探讨水稻土施用养殖废弃物有机肥的适宜替代比例,采用盆栽试验,研究了等养分条件下化肥配合施用30%、50%、60%、75%、100%的牛粪有机肥和猪粪有机肥对于水稻产量及氮素吸收利用的影响。结果表明:水稻土施用60%牛粪有机肥+化肥处理的稻谷产量显著高于其他处理,施用50%~100%的猪粪有机肥+化肥处理的稻谷产量显著高于30%猪粪有机肥+化肥处理;30%牛粪有机肥+化肥、30%猪粪有机肥+化肥处理的稻谷全氮含量显著高于其他处理;在等氮量条件下,60%~100%的牛粪有机肥替代化肥、50%~100%的猪粪有机肥替代化肥均有助于水稻对氮素的吸收利用,氮素收获指数和氮素利用效率均有所提高。总体上,土壤有机质与全氮含量丰富的水稻土施用60%的牛粪有机肥或猪粪有机肥替代化肥,有利于提高稻谷产量与氮肥利用率。In order to explore the suitable application ratio of breeding waste as organic fertilizer in paddy soil,a pot experiment was conducted to study the effects of 30%,50%,60%,75% and 100% cow manure or pig manure combined with chemical fertilizer on rice yield and nitrogen absorption and utilization under equal nutrient conditions.The results showed that the rice yield of 60% cow manure+chemical fertilizer treatment was significantly higher than that of the other treatments,and the rice yield of 50%-100% pig manure+chemical fertilizer treatment was significantly higher than that of 30% pig manure+chemical fertilizer treatment.The total nitrogen content of rice grain in 30% cow manure+chemical fertilizer treatment or in 30% pig manure+chemical fertilizer treatment was significantly higher than that in the other treatments.Under the condition of equal nitrogen amount,60%-100% cow manure instead of chemical fertilizer and 50%-100% pig manure instead of chemical fertilizer both facilitated the absorption and utilization of nitrogen by rice,and the nitrogen harvest index and nitrogen use efficiency were improved.In general,the application of 60% cow manure or pig manure instead of partial chemical fertilizer to paddy soil with rich organic matter and total nitrogen is beneficial to improving rice yield and nitrogen use efficiency.

关 键 词:水稻土 替代化肥比例 氮素吸收利用 水稻产量
